RediMed Colts Young Guns Round 3

Round 3 of the WAFL Colts competition saw West Perth defeat Subiaco by five points, Peel Thunder take home a 68-point victory over South Fremantle, Claremont secure a 61-point win over Perth and Swan Districts defeat East Perth by nine points.

Round 2 RediMed Colts Young Gun was Luke English from Perth FC who collected 118 votes, closely followed by West Perth player Kurt Monaghan.
